ESSENTIALS
| Topic | Details |
|---|---|
| 🏙️ City | Kololi, Kanifing District, The Gambia |
| 👥 Population | Approximately 12,000 |
| 💻 Internet Speed | Average 10-20 Mbps; Fiber available in hubs like Senegambia Beach Hotel area |
| 💸 Currency & Banking | Gambian Dalasi (GMD); 1 USD ≈ 68 GMD, 1 EUR ≈ 74 GMD |
| 🚰 Tap Water | Not drinkable; bottled water (20L for 250 GMD) is recommended |
| 🔌 Power | 230V, 50Hz, 🔌 Type G (UK style); frequent outages, backup generators common in hotels |
| 📶 SIM Card | Africell or QCell; 10GB data costs approx. 600 GMD ($9) |
| 💳 Banking for Expats | Standard Chartered, Ecobank; ATMs at Senegambia Strip accept Visa/Mastercard |
| 🛌 Accommodation | Guesthouses and boutique hotels; Airbnb is increasingly popular |
| 💳 Cashless Friendly | Mostly No; cash is king. Card accepted only in large hotels and high-end restaurants |
| 🏠 Short Term Rentals | Airbnb, Booking.com (approx. $30-$60/night for decent apartments) |
| 🛏️ Budget Accommodation | Leybato Beach Hotel ($25/night), Kairaba Avenue guesthouses |
| 🏙️ Best Area to Stay for Tourists | Senegambia Strip (active nightlife, near beach) |
| 🏙️ Best Area to Stay for Digital Nomads | Kotu or Bijilo (quieter, newer residential apartments, better value) |
WORKING AND NETWORKING
| Topic | Details |
|---|---|
| 🏢 Best Coworking Space | InnovaCowork (Kotu, near Kololi); daily passes approx. 500 GMD |
| ☕ Best Cafe for Work | Gaya Art Cafe (Senegambia); quiet mornings, good Wi-Fi, excellent coffee |
| 💼 Networking Events | Gambia Chamber of Commerce mixers; occasional expat meetups at Leo's Beach Hotel |
| 🥂 Social Events for Expats | Friday nights at 'The Strip' or 'Expats in The Gambia' Facebook group meetups |
TRANSPORTATION
| Topic | Details |
|---|---|
| 🚕 Best Taxi/Ride App | No major apps; use 'Yellow Taxis' for shared rides or 'Green Taxis' for private 'Town Trips' ($5-$10) |
| 🚲 Bike/Scooter Rental | Local rentals near Senegambia; approx. 400 GMD per day |
| 🏖️ Best Beach Nearby | Kololi Beach (Senegambia); fine sand but watch for strong currents |
| ✈️ Top Regional Airline | Air Senegal (Connects to Dakar) |
| ✈️ Top International Airline | Brussels Airlines, Turkish Airlines, Royal Air Maroc |
| 🛣️ Highway Access | Bertil Harding Highway (Main artery connecting the coast to the airport) |
| 🚉 Main Train/Transit Hub | No trains; Serekunda Bush Taxi Station is the main transport hub |
| 🚍 Public Transport Passes | No formal passes; pay-as-you-go shared vans (Gele-Geles) for 15-25 GMD |
| ✈️ Regional Travel | Shared taxis to Banjul or cross-border bush taxis to Casamance, Senegal |

BUSINESS
| Topic | Details |
|---|---|
| 🏢 Studio Purchase Price (City Center) | Approx. $1,100 per m² ($44,000 for 40m² modern unit) |
| 🏢 Studio Purchase Price (Outside City) | Approx. $750 per m² ($30,000 for 40m²) |
| 🏠 1-Bedroom Purchase Price (City Center) | Approx. $1,000 per m² ($60,000 for 60m²) |
| 🏠 1-Bedroom Purchase Price (Outside City) | Approx. $650 per m² ($39,000 for 60m²) |
| 🏡 2-Bedroom Purchase Price (City Center) | Approx. $950 per m² ($76,000 for 80m²) |
| 🏡 2-Bedroom Purchase Price (Outside City) | Approx. $600 per m² ($48,000 for 80m²) |
| 💼 Corporate Tax | 27% or 1% of turnover (whichever is higher) |
| 💵 Dividend Withholding Tax | 15% |
| 🏦 Tax System | Source-based and resident-based taxation |
| 📈 Highest Income Tax Bracket | 25% (for income above 50,000 GMD) |
| 🧾 VAT | 15% |
| 🌐 Controlled Foreign Company (CFC) Rules | Minimal/None |
| 🏠 Property Tax | Yes, based on local municipal rates (Kanifing Municipal Council) |
| 🏠 Property Transaction Tax | Capital Gains Tax (5% for individuals on disposal) |
| 💻 Attractive Tax System for Digital Nomads | No specific nomad visa; most stay on 90-day tourist visas/extensions |
